Office fraud
From: -Anonymous-Date posted: 10/7/2008
Years at this apartment: 2003 - 2008
2 years ago I was told that everyone in the apartment complex would have to start paying for water which I could deal with. #20.oo a month was pretty reasonable. We had to send our payment to some company in another state (which to this day makes no sense to me). I personally believe this was a bogus company to make us think a real water company was involved. A few months ago we were told to include our water payment with our rent. A flat fee of 21.50 (per person!) is to be paid. My next door neighbor has a wife and 3 kids. They must pay 107.50 a month!!!!!! Noone checks the water meter ever and I think people are being cheated out of money. Recently I recieved a letter saying my account was audited and that I owed for 2 months for my water bill. I disputed this knowing that my bill was paid in full. I was theatened with eviction and forced to pay. Many other residents recieved this letter too. I have decided to contact the Fair housing commitee and maybe Mapleview will have their own Audit
